## Step 4: Repoint the thumbnail queue

After the Glimmerbox workers are drained, the thumbnail generation queue must be repointed to the new Fernwick cluster. New jobs will pause automatically once the queue depth hits zero, so there is no need to stop producers manually. Verify the drain in the Ostler dashboard before continuing. Once confirmed, update the worker config to use the connection string below.

primary connection of yagep-kahip = redis://giliel_svc:zYiKsLL2PLpfPL@db-348f.xolmarsys.corp:5432/fenwyn

CI note for the release manager: the Quillsearch autocomplete index job has been crawling — 40+ minutes instead of the usual 8. Looks like the tokenizer cache isn't warming on the new Harlow runners, so every shard rebuilds from scratch. Short-term fix: pin the job to the old runner pool and it drops back to normal. Don't block the release on this. The slow run's trace token is recorded below.

trace token, tawep-fahif: htk3_b58

## Onboarding: Soft Deletes in the Orders Table

At Marlowe Commerce, rows in `orders` are never hard-deleted. A `deleted_at` timestamp marks soft deletion; all release queries must filter on it. Purges run quarterly via the Tidehook job, which the release manager approves. Before approving a purge, snapshot the table and verify row counts against the ledger. The snapshot archive is encrypted, and restoring it requires the passphrase noted below.

unlock words, hahip-baduf: holwyn-istath-julvan

Ticket QF-2281: Firmware channel mixup on Lumenbox hubs. Devices enrolled in the "steady" channel are pulling builds from "canary" after the enrollment refactor. Looks like the channel key gets lowercased in one path but not the other — see `channel_resolver.go`. Fix normalizes at ingest and adds a regression test. Reviewer: please double-check the migration for existing enrollments. The offending firmware build is noted below for reference.

build token for tawip-yageg: htk9_92ac43d42